Responsibilities

  • Provide support and excellent customer service to internal staff for payment operational areas (e.g., Wires, ACH, Cash Services, Items Processing, Exception Item Processing, Check Services, Faster Payments, Statement Rendering and Research, regulatory/compliance objectives)
  • Complete tasks accurately and timely while observing segregation of duties
  • Monitor functionality of automated processes and escalate potential issues
  • Complete assigned duties timely and escalate to leadership if concerns arise with meeting key processing deadlines
  • Provide telephone and e-mail support to internal clients
  • Escalate identified opportunities for process improvements in line with business line strategies
  • Assist with special projects related to operations (e.g., system conversions, acquisitions)
  • Comply with policies, procedures, security requirements, and government regulations
  • Ensure client data remains confidential and secure
  • Ensure processes are completed in accordance with Bank policies and key processing deadlines are met
  • Support branches and bank staff through review and documentation of critical and regulatory functions
  • Support the bank's strategic business plans, projects, and processes

About Banner Bank

Banner Bank provides a variety of financial services to individuals and businesses in the Western United States, including checking and savings accounts, loans, mortgages, and investment services. The bank operates over 200 locations across Washington, Oregon, California, and Idaho, managing assets of more than $12.6 billion. Its products work by offering tailored financial solutions and expert guidance to meet the specific needs of each client, ensuring personalized service. Unlike many competitors, Banner Bank emphasizes quality, teamwork, and community involvement, which has earned it accolades such as being named the Best Bank in the Pacific Region by Money Magazine and receiving a five-star rating from Bauer Financial for financial strength. The goal of Banner Bank is to provide exceptional financial services while fostering strong community ties and ensuring customer satisfaction.
